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dunston to Wainfleet start from as little as £19.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dunston to Wainfleet start from £65.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dunston to Wainfleet are available for £98.20 one way

Facilities and Ticketing at Dunston

Despite being unstaffed, Dunston station is well-equipped for travelers. There are no ticket offices, but you’ll find ticket machines readily available for all your ticket collection needs, including accessibility for those with disabilities. While smartcards can’t be issued or validated here, the seamless use of online ticket collections ensures you can plan your travels effortlessly.

For those needing assistance, help points are stationed on-site, ensuring that any issues can be quickly addressed. Should you need aid, you can also call the helpline at 08002006060. All this makes Dunston a practical choice for commuters, despite not having amenities like refreshment facilities, ATMs, or waiting areas.

Facilities and Amenities at Wainfleet Train Station

Wainfleet station may be small, but it offers the essential conveniences for travelers on their way. Though the station lacks a formal ticket office, there's no need to worry. Ticket machines are available for you to purchase and collect your tickets with ease, albeit they aren't accessible for those with mobility impairments. For those with hearing needs, an induction loop is available to ensure smooth communication.

While waiting at the station, you’ll find basic amenities are limited. There are no waiting rooms or seating areas, and travelers should plan ahead if requiring refreshments, as no food or drink facilities are on-site. Unfortunately, amenities for accessibility such as ramps for train access, ticket barriers, and accessible toilets are not provided, requiring careful planning of your station experience if accessibility is a concern. Wainfleet does, however, interest cyclists with dedicated bicycle storage features comprising stands for a handful of bikes.

Onward Travel Options

Connecting further afield from Wainfleet station is manageable with several transport options at your disposal. Rail replacement services can be accessed easily on the main road adjacent to the level crossing from the Boston bound platform. Need a lift? Local taxis operated by M Rust can be reached at 01754 880505 for convenient journeys in and around the area.

For those looking to use local bus services, comprehensive information is available online, ensuring travelers can effectively plan their onward journey. By accessing a printable format of the bus services, travelers can easily integrate bus routes into their travel plans.
